WHO WE ARE
In 1971, we opened doors in Chelmsford, MA before moving headquarters to Southern California. From our inception we’ve been committed to innovation and world-class service, building off our company values of Quality, Teamwork, Respect, Honesty, Integrity, and Responsibility. Now an employee-owned company, NAVCO is one of the largest security integrators in the country, with security experts who are personally invested and dedicated to creating a safer and more financially secure environment for all.

SUMMARY:
The Pre-Configuration Specialist position duties will be to oversee the execution of day-to-day functions of the department such as Pre-Configuring installation for NAVCO customers such as Chase, UNFI, and Wells Fargo.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
• Working within CRM
• The ability to work with Openeye, Verint, Hanwha and March products
• The ability to locate and upgrade firmware on cameras/NVRs.
• Work together with the shipping department to get the pre-configured product sent out to correct warehouse in time for installation
• Train on products as necessary
• Communicate and work well in a team environment
• Must be able to work with minimal supervision
• Proficient in Microsoft Office
